Top Pregnancy Care Challenges and How to Address Them
- Stretch Marks
Stretch marks are a common concern for expectant mothers, appearing as the skin stretches rapidly to accommodate a growing baby. The best way to minimize them is by using a stretch mark cream for pregnant women early on. These creams are formulated with ingredients like shea butter, cocoa butter, and vitamin E to deeply hydrate the skin and improve elasticity.
Tips for Choosing a Stretch Mark Cream:
- Look for products labeled safe for pregnancy, free from harmful chemicals like parabens and phthalates.
- Opt for creams with natural oils and vitamins for optimal hydration.
- Start using the cream from the first trimester and continue postpartum for best results.
During pregnancy, hormonal changes can lead to skin sensitivity, dryness, or acne. A proper pregnancy skin care routine tailored to these needs can help.
Skin Care Recommendations:
- Use a gentle, fragrance-free cleanser to avoid irritation.
- Apply a lightweight moisturizer with ingredients like aloe vera or hyaluronic acid.
- Always wear sunscreen to protect your skin from UV damage, as pregnancy can make your skin more prone to dark spots.

- Managing Melasma During Pregnancy
Melasma, or the “mask of pregnancy,” often appears as dark patches on the face due to hormonal changes. While it’s common and temporary, managing it requires special care.
Key Tips to Prevent and Manage Melasma:
Sun Protection: Use a pregnancy-safe, broad-spectrum sunscreen with zinc oxide or titanium dioxide daily. Avoid peak sun hours.
Gentle Skincare: Opt for mild cleansers and hydrating products with niacinamide, vitamin C, or azelaic acid to brighten skin safely.
Diet: Incorporate antioxidant-rich foods like berries, leafy greens, and nuts to support skin health.
Key Ingredients to Look For:
- Safe Brightening Agents: Azelaic acid, vitamin C, and niacinamide for reducing pigmentation.
- Hydrating Elements: Hyaluronic acid and ceramides to maintain skin moisture.
Consult a dermatologist for persistent melasma postpartum.

- Frequently Asked Questions
- When Should I Start Using Stretch Mark Cream?
- It’s best to start using a stretch mark cream for pregnant women as early as the first trimester. Consistent use throughout pregnancy can significantly reduce the likelihood of stretch marks.
- Can I Use Regular Skin Care Products During Pregnancy?
- Not all regular skin care products are safe during pregnancy. Always check labels and avoid products with retinoids, salicylic acid, or high levels of vitamin A.
- How Often Should I Use Postpartum Massage Oil?
- You can use postpartum massage oil for mothers daily or as needed, especially after a warm shower, to help relax muscles and hydrate the skin.
- Are Natural Products Always Safe for Pregnancy?
- While natural products are generally safer, it’s still important to verify their safety for pregnancy.
